United Way Achieves 4-Star Charity Navigator Rating

If you are worried about how your donated dollars are being spent, good news. United Way of the Plains recently earned its sixth consecutive four-star rating from Charity Navigator, an organization that rates nonprofits based on two areas: financial health, and accountability and transparency.
